Transaction 27e06ab4868e5704d8c06e589a3f201cb89e574740ba12033f92568eb4afaa15

1 Input
2 Outputs
  • 27e06ab4868e5704d8c06e589a3f201cb89e574740ba12033f92568eb4afaa15:0
  • value  518036267
    address  1JJkVMZqz4YK4GWSJXuTsQdQr6GJPccZuk
  • 27e06ab4868e5704d8c06e589a3f201cb89e574740ba12033f92568eb4afaa15:1
  • value  100367091
    address  192p161q95ktSdZsWHC7CMkN3JsdhawT1B